The number of students graduating from the 9 accredited political science schools in Idaho is increasing. In 2006 there were 136 political science graduates from political science courses in Idaho and in 2010 there were 226 graduates.
There was an increase in the number of political science school degree or certificate graduates in Idaho by 66%. Most of these graduates, or 43%, earned a bachelor's degree in political science.
